add width parameter in plugin

This commit is contained in:
philippe44
2020-01-16 00:31:16 -08:00
parent 3b74588741
commit 5a4181642f
8 changed files with 71 additions and 14 deletions

View File

@@ -8,7 +8,9 @@ use Slim::Utils::Log;
my $prefs = preferences('plugin.squeezeesp32');
$prefs->init();
$prefs->init({
width => 128,
});
my $log = Slim::Utils::Log->addLogCategory({
'category' => 'plugin.squeezeesp32',
@@ -18,6 +20,11 @@ my $log = Slim::Utils::Log->addLogCategory({
sub initPlugin {
my $class = shift;
if ( main::WEBUI ) {
require Plugins::SqueezeESP32::Settings;
Plugins::SqueezeESP32::Settings->new;
}
$class->SUPER::initPlugin(@_);
Slim::Networking::Slimproto::addPlayerClass($class, 100, 'squeezeesp32', { client => 'Plugins::SqueezeESP32::Player', display => 'Plugins::SqueezeESP32::Graphics' });